I've been collaborating with someone in one of my repos for a while. A few months back, he created an Atlassian account, logged into BB, and I was able to grant him permission in the repo settings page. As I started typing his name in the user picker - his ID appeared, no problem.
Yesterday I added another repo to the project and tried to grant him access from the repo settings as before, but his ID does not appear in the user picker at all. He has logged in and verified he can still access the older repos, and I see him in the access lists for those as well.
It had been a few weeks since he last logged in, so I wondered, if the user picker only lists recent users, and his recent session hasn't propagated thru the system yet?
Does anyone have any info on this, or how he can get himself back on the visible user list?
We are using the free plan, he shows as active on that, and we are not exceeding the user limit of 5.

I've tried reproducing this and I encountered the same issue when trying to add some of my friends to my repositories. I know they have a Bitbucket account but they won't show up when I start typing their email address or username. However, I noticed that if you type the whole username and then press enter, they'll be added. This is just a workaround, as the names should be appearing in the list.
I've gone ahead and reported this bug, you can find it at Issues #18079. Feel free to watch it for further updates.
